Platform Security Measures and User Data Protection
Security is one of the most critical trust factors for any online service involving financial transactions. A legitimate platform must protect user data from unauthorized access and misuse. This includes personal information, payment details, and account activity. Strong security systems reduce the risk of fraud and build confidence among users who play games or purchase lottery tickets online.
Common security features users should expect
- Encrypted connections to protect data transmission
- Secure login systems with password protection and verification steps
- Regular system monitoring to detect unusual activity
- Clear privacy policies explaining how user data is handled
Fair Play Systems and Game Integrity Standards
Fair play is essential for online games and lottery draws. Players need assurance that outcomes are not manipulated and that everyone has an equal chance based on the rules. Legitimate platforms rely on standardized systems to ensure fairness across all games. These systems are often tested and audited to confirm that results are random and unbiased.
Indicators of fair play practices
- Use of random number generation technology for games and draws
- Published rules that clearly explain how outcomes are determined
- Separation between game operation and user accounts
- Independent testing or certification where applicable

Payment Processing Reliability and Financial Trust Factors
Handling money responsibly is a major sign of legitimacy. A trustworthy platform processes deposits and withdrawals accurately and within stated timeframes. Delays, hidden fees, or unclear payment rules often signal deeper problems. Reliable financial systems show that the platform values long-term trust over short-term gains.
Signs of reliable payment handling
- Multiple payment options to suit different users
- Clearly stated processing times for withdrawals
- Transaction records available in user accounts
- Customer support assistance for payment-related questions
